Using the example we used above, if the third base coach touches, in order, arm, belt, nose, ear, belt, nose, arm, nose then the bunt is on because the first sign after the indicator was nose, which means bunt. The important thing for this system is that the players do not look away as soon as they get the signal. No funny business. If one of them takes their attention away before the sequence is finished, its telling the opposition that the sign has already been given and it might contribute to their picking up signs that way.
